Subject: Handover — Ledgerline report builder release

Hi — welcome aboard. The open item this cycle is sorting stability in the Ledgerline report builder: the grouped-export path uses an unstable sort, so rows with equal keys shuffle between runs and break snapshot diffs. The fix (switch to the stable comparator in `sortcore`) is merged and waiting on release 3.9. You'll need to sign the release bundle yourself; the deploy key is below.

signing key of bagap-yawep = bky13_TbfT6ZMUoGJo2

Runbook: Doclint rollout status for the weekly sync. The doclint service now scans every merge to the Harborfield docs repo and flags broken anchors, stale frontmatter, and headings that skip levels. False positives dropped after Priya's tokenizer fix, so we re-enabled blocking mode on the style checks. If the linter hangs, restart the worker pool before touching the queue; a hung scan usually clears within two minutes. The settings below are what production currently runs with, so verify against them before filing a bug.

settings of fadup-kajog:
[casox]
port = 3000
team = jorix
host = casox.paliqio.example
region = lower-4
access_code = ac_dd069a
timeout_ms = 750

- [ ] **Step 7: Breaker override escrow.** After sealing the signing keys for the Tallgrove upstream API circuit breaker, confirm the support team can force the breaker open during a full outage. The override bundle lives in the sealed escrow drawer and is useless without its unlock phrase. Two ceremony witnesses must initial this step before proceeding. The escrow bundle is decrypted with the recovery passphrase that follows.

vault phrase of kahip-kahop = holath-quenmir

Non-sensitive settings—watering window, zone count, and soil-moisture thresholds—are documented in env.example with safe defaults, and reviewers should verify any changes against that file. Timezone handling is explicit: set SCHEDULER_TZ rather than relying on the host. One value is deliberately absent from env.example because it grants write access to the valve controller; when preparing a local environment, it is added as the next line.

vault entry, yahif-yajep: COURIER_KEY29=b802bdf8034096b65a51c6ba5abe2